The story

In the rainforest, fallen trees become nurse logs. Tree seedlings establish along the elevated, decaying trunks, gaining access to light above the saturated forest floor. As the original log fully decomposes, the surviving trees remain in a distinctive straight row, a hallmark pattern of old-growth temperate rainforest regeneration.

There's a small thing worth knowing about how this forest renews itself. When a giant tree finally falls, that's not the end. It becomes a nurse log. As the trunk slowly rots, seedlings sprout right along the top of it, lifted up off the soggy ground and into the light. Years later you'll see whole rows of mature trees standing in a perfectly straight line, all of them rooted in a single fallen ancestor that's long since vanished into soil.
